
THE 400 BLOWS
FRANÇOIS TRUFFAUT | FRANCE | 1959| 99 MIN | NR | FRENCH | ENGLISH SUBTITLES
Part of the Sight and Sound 100 series
BFI’s 2022 Sight & Sound List #50
Snagging the Best Director award at Cannes in 1959, Truffaut’s directorial debut captures the dissolution of childhood as the world of crime becomes a lucrative escape for young Antoine, a neglected Parisian boy.
Cast: Jean-Pierre Léaud, Albert Rémy, Claire Maurier
